WebOct 21, 2024 · Digging Your Hole and Drain Lines. 1. Dig a 4 by 4 ft (1.2 by 1.2 m) hole where you want the dry well. Use a long-handled shovel to start digging where you want your well to go. Start in the center by pointing the head of your shovel into the well. Use the heel of your shoe to punch the shovel into the ground. WebJan 30, 2014 · Installing the drainpipe (perforations down) from the catch basin to the dry well follows. Cut a hole in the container just large enough for one end of the drainpipe to fit through. The drainpipe should protrude into the container about 2- to 3-inches. The drainage grate should be connected to the other end and back-filled.
